Answering Docs question, Jared says that the United States has reached racial equality, claiming that people who complain about racism are just being divisive. Sarah-Jane (or SJ, a white girl who is Justyces partner on the debate team) takes issue with this statement, trying to show Jared that he only thinks racism is a thing of the past because he himself has never experienced it. Furthermore, she upholds that Mannys obscene gesture could have been perceived as a threat. What she fails to mention is that Garrett Tison was screaming insults and slurs at Manny and Justyce, blatantly displaying his anger in a way that was much more threatening than anything the boys themselves were doing.
